
Honto ni Atta! Noroi No Video 70
Horror
2016
100
Dominating the top spot among psychic horror documentaries. Can you face the truth reflected by the camera? A video of the Marionette poster's husband playing with the puppets he bought for his daughter. A bloody woman's face is reflected on the edge of the shelf behind her husband's puppet. Six other posted videos are included.